The central anchor of the song is the phrase “Okwa Chukwu na-eme Eze n'uwa” (It is God who makes a King in this world). Somval uses this to remind listeners that human effort alone does not guarantee success. True elevation, leadership, and wealth come exclusively from divine favor. 3. : The climax of the story is the transformation of the "ogbenye" (poor person) into "ogaranya" (a wealthy or prominent person) through divine grace. The song emphasizes that God is the one who crowns kings ("Chukwu na-eme Eze"), even when the world thinks it is impossible.
